Postmates has acqui-hired mobile app developer Hey for an undisclosed sum, giving an exit to GV, the unit formerly known as Google Ventures.

GV, the corporate venturing subsidiary of internet technology group Alphabet, has exited US-based mobile journal developer Hey through an acquisition by local services gateway Postmates, TechCrunch reported yesterday.

Founded in 2012, Hey had developed an automatic journal app called Heyday as well as Stolen, a trading platform for Twitter profiles that was later relaunched as a celebrity-based trading game called Famous.
